Gowanus, notoriously known for its industrial grit and its less than pristine canal, has experienced a major revitalization in the past few years. Gone are the dilapidated warehouses and in their place are converted coworking spaces, luxury high-rises, and local microbreweries. On Baltic Street, this event space sits on the border with Boerum Hill and Park Slope, benefitting from its close proximity to the Barclays Center.

The Barclays Center, a 10-minute walk away, is a huge draw for big crowds catching a Nets game or a Jay-Z concert depending on the night. Closer to Baltic, Littlefield is a performance space that’s popular with the more artsy types. When it’s warm out, Pig Beach is where you’ll find colorfully-dressed patrons having a beer and a rack of ribs on an outdoor bench. The Atlantic Terminal hub is nearby, providing easy access to the 2/3/4/5 and B/Q trains.
On the same block is a glass and mirror manufacturer and half a block down is Gotham Archery, an indoor archery range. Brooklyn Boulders is around the corner, a rock climbing space that’s popular with the younger crowd who like to keep in shape without hitting the gym.
The space itself is huge but this part of Baltic Street doesn’t see a ton of foot traffic.
